About This Home

Beautiful old Florida living. 6/3.5 plus den. Private canal. Views of New River. No bridges to bay. Large lot, almost half an acre with beautiful Oak Trees. Property has 2 masters, one on ground floor. Newer addition was build 3 steps up. Convenient to I-95, Turnpike, Hard Rock Hotel and downtown Fort Lauderdale. Property currently rented.
